2D–2D WO3–Bi2WO6 photocatalyst with an S-scheme heterojunction for highly efficient Cr(vi) reduction

Abstract: A two-dimensional (2D)-2D WO3-Bi2WO6 photocatalyst is developed by using a hydrothermal method. Ultrathin Bi2WO6 nanosheets are grown on the surface of WO3 nanoplates by crystal-oriented epitaxy. The 2D-2D WO3-Bi2WO6...

“…[416,417] Other 2D/2D heterojunctions but not atomically thin such as Z-scheme BiOCl/g-C 3 N 4 nanosheets showed ≈94% reduction after 2h irradiation and the Bi 2 MoO 6 /Ti 3 C 2 nanocomposites showed ≈100% reduction after 60 min irradiation. [418,419] These observations in turn suggest that the ultrathin dimension of 2D materials can excel in photocatalytic process as compared to other bulk and lowdimensional structure of the similar materials. Accordingly, few more examples of ultrathin 2D photocatalytic systems employed for heavy metal reduction are given in Table 6.…”
